Freeze Away Unwanted Body Fat

You’ve probably heard that you can successfully freeze away unwanted body fat with CoolSculpting. It’s been a great tool we’ve used to help patients for more than a decade. But now there is something even better – CoolSculpting Elite. This new system is faster than its predecessor, and it provides better results because the curved applicators treat nearly 20% more surface area. If you loved CoolSculpting, you will adore CoolSculpting Elite.

Lift and Tighten Skin

Addressing issues of skin laxity and crepiness on the body presents a serious challenge. You can apply all the skin-firming lotion you want, but it won’t make a noticeable, lasting difference. However, using dermal fillers like Radiesse and Sculptra can improve these issues on the body just like they do on the face. We use dermal fillers to provide a non-surgical a butt lift, boost the appearance of saggy knees, and tackle crepey skin on the upper arms. This treatment offers a successful way to correct crepey skin, laxity issues and even cellulite. And unlike a topical solution, it gives you results that last for about 12 months!
